Dublinia

St Michaels Hill, Christchurch, Dublin 8.

Dublinia is one of Dublins top visitor attractions with three exciting exhibitions, Viking Dublin, Medieval Dublin and History Hunters! All located at the historic crossroads of old Dublin.

The Viking and Medieval Dublin exhibitions bring the city to life in an exciting and contemporary way for all ages to learn and share. See what life was really like onboard a Viking warship, visit a Viking house and learn of their myths and mysteries. Learn all about the death and disease of Dublin in medieval times, experience the Dublin fair and visit a bustling medieval street. Finally, unearth the citys past at the History Hunters exhibition; see how archaeology works with history and science to put together the pieces of our past. Visit the lab, and also see real Viking and Medieval artifacts (on loan from the National Museum.

On a Living History Day, every weekend June to September, you will meet Olaf the Viking Coin Minter. As an added bonus, costumed guides will take you through the exhibition at 2.30pm everyday (except in July).

Opening Times

March to September: Daily 10.00 to 17.00
October to February: Daily 10.00 to 16.30

Admission Prices:

Adult: €7.50, Child: €5.00, Senior Citizen: €6.50, Student: €6.50, Family Ticket: €23.00 (2 x adults and 2 x children). Under 5s are admitted free.
